+ | ===[[Glossary:Ultra-widescreen|Ultra-widescreen]]=== | ||
+ | {{ii}} By default, the game is limited to 16:9 resolutions. | ||
+ | |||
+ | {{Fixbox|description=Hex values change for unlock all resolutions|fix= | ||
+ | # Download HxD hex editor from [https://mh-nexus.de/en/hxd/ here] | ||
+ | # Open HxD hex editor and click on <code>File</code> then <code>Open</code> | ||
+ | # Choose <code>UnityPlayer.dll</code> found in <code>{{P|steam}}\steamapps\common\Vigil The Longest Night\</code> | ||
+ | # Click on <code>Search</code>, then <code>Find</code> and choose the <code>Hex-values</code> tab | ||
+ | # In the <code>Search for:</code> box, type <code>75 08 5F 32 C0 5E 5D C2 08 00 5F B0 01 5E 5D C2 08 00</code> and replace value you find with <code>75 08 5F B0 01 5E 5D C2 08 00 5F B0 01 5E 5D C2 08 00</code> | ||
+ | # Save and exit | ||
+ | |||
+ | {{--}} Some backgrounds remain limited to 16:9 | ||
